MECHANICAL THFORV
The
800XL
computer
console
contains
a
single
motherboard
which
houses
all
the
chips
of the
system
and
provides
connectors
for
interfacing
external
modules
to
the
console.
It
includes
the
CPU
,
RAM
,
OS
and
BASIC
ROM's.
The
motherboard
uses
a
common
address
bus,
data
bus
aid
clock
lines.
The
sixteen-line
address
bus
allows
the
microprocessor
to
directly
address
64K
memory
locations.
The
eight-
line
data
bus
provides
the
communication
and
data
path
between
the
functional
modules.
The
power
is
provided
by
an
external
power
supply
and
routed
throughout
the
console
The
keyboard
is
the
user
interface
with
the
computer.
The
keyboard
connects
to
the
PC
Board
by
a
24-connector
ribbon
cable.
All
peripherals
connect
to the
800XL
either
through
the
SIO
connector
or
the
PBI.
Power
enters
through
the
7-Pin
DIN
connector
on
the
rear
panel.
Power
On/Off
is
controlled
by the
ON/OFF
switch
on
the
rear
panel.
RF
to
the TV
switchbox
arrives
from
an
RCA
phonoconnector
and
RF
cable.
Composite
Video
composite
luminance,
and
audio
signals
to
the
monitor
arrive
from
a 5
pin
DIN
monitor
jack
on
the
reer
panel.
ELECTRICAL THFORV
DIGITAL
HARDWARE
The
digital
hardware
consists
of:
*
The
6502C
CPU
microprocessor
*
The
Alphanumeric
Television
Interface
Controller
(ANTIC)
*
The
Graphics
Television
Interface
Adaptor
( GTIA)
*
The
POT
KEYboard
Intecrated
Circuit
(
POKEY)
*
The
Peripheral
Interface
Adaptor
(PIA)
*
The
Memory
(Operating
System
ROM
,
64K RAM
,
Atari
BASIC
ROM
,
Rev.
B)
*
Miscellaneous
Logic
Memory
Management
Unit
(
MMU)
Delay
Line
*
Parallel
Bus
Interface
(
PBI
)

Atari 800XL Specifications

General IconGeneral
ManufacturerAtari
TypeHome computer
Release year1983
CPUMOS Technology 6502C
RAM64 KB
ROM24 KB
Operating SystemAtari OS
CPU Speed1.79 MHz (NTSC) / 1.77 MHz (PAL)
GraphicsANTIC and GTIA chips
Display resolution160×192 to 320×192 pixels
SoundPOKEY chip
StorageCassette tape, floppy disk
PortsSerial, parallel, monitor, joystick ports
